What is Cloudera Data Flow?
Cloudera DataFlow is a cloud-native data service powered by Apache NiFi that facilitates universal data distribution by streamlining the end-to-end process of data movement. It offers features such as 450+ agnostic connectors, no-code developer self-service, and auto-scaling capabilities for building and deploying scalable data pipelines. Cloudera DataFlow supports flexible deployment options including public cloud, private cloud, and Kubernetes, ensuring seamless data movement across hybrid environments.
